Output 31c6c93b892065eab066e5319058357ee9e4434882c584a8768233a1b22aeb84: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702ae1821257ff8018b66d0035e290e5e0e92c3f OP_EQUAL
address
MJ8FHLCCpkNKYhvTpC2sYhyoTL1sEW9y8s
transaction
31c6c93b892065eab066e5319058357ee9e4434882c584a8768233a1b22aeb84
spent
true